I like to give something from each of the following categories:
A product you love
1. Fels-Naptha Laundry Soap Miracle soap, I tell you. Run hot water, scour with this soap and then let it soak. You will never know poopacalypse ever happened in the middle of a restaurant when you forgot another onesie, except for the scar it leaves on your soul.
2. A pack of your favorite wipes These wipes are real soft, y’all. Real soft.
3. Healing Balm As I’ve mentioned here, here, and here, I slather this balm on everything. Cradle cap, scratches, mosquito bites, everything.
4. Best soap for washing bottles. I buy it for everyone having a baby.
